I should have replied with a comment about this:
"The carrageenan is probably a sensitivity to the sulphides. It's a protein
binder so it shows up in a number of things other than dairy. Be sure to
check the label on processed food. Some of the organic brands leave it out,
and would be useable."
I was surprised, once I started looking at the information online, that it
is often not listed in the ingredients because it is used in 'processing'.
So I am determined to be extra-vigilant. Luckily the diner has been living
with the sensitivity for a very long time and has already given me a couple
of lists on dairy-type products she can tolerate.
